The effect of the Canada Pension Plan on personal retirement saving : some new evidence from cross-section tax data / by Michael J. Daly.EC22-3/1981-206E-PDF

"This paper presents some new Canadian evidence on the extent to which personal saving responds to changes in the public pension system. Econometric analysis of a new data base, which provides information on contributions to Registered Retirement Savings Plans, occupational pension schemes and the Canada Pension Plan,according to the age and taxable income class of tax-filers reveals that the Canada Pension Plan has had a strong negative effect on personal retirement saving"--Abstract, p. ii.
